As promised by Activision, Nicki Minaj is now bringing the blast of pink to the Call Of Duty universe.

In Call Of Duty: Warzone 2 and Modern Warfare 2, Nicki Minaj is now a playable character. Her special ending move includes her stepping on enemies with her sky-high heels on.

Her character hitting the battlefield is awesome, along with the fact that the heels her character has are the highest heels ever seen in a first-person shooter.

Activision in July announced that Snoop Dogg, Nicki Minaj, and 21 Savage would be added. This marks the game’s way to celebrate fifty years of hip-hop.

Minaj’s arrival is significant in other ways as well, as she is the first self-named female Operator. The gamers can check out the trailer for her Operator bundle.

Details of Nicki Minaj’s Character

This Operator bundle featuring Nicki Minaj and Tracer pack can be purchased in the game store of Call Of Duty. Currently, Snoop Dogg’s and Nicki’s cosmetic content is available. She is comprising her character herself.

Other things include the Get Bodied finishing move, The Baddest battle rifle blueprint, Nicki Whip LTV skin, Super Freaky shotgun blueprint, Ice Cream Nicki emblem, That’s My Ice Cream sticker, and Nice And Nicki loading screen.

The Get Bodied finishing move in this list is the one that is receiving a lot of attention. For those who are wondering what finishing moves are, they are a method to eliminate the enemy in a single-hit execution.

This special animation is specific to the character that the other player will be using.

Get Bodied shows Nicki Minaj leaps on the back of the enemy player and slams her heel into their cervical and lumbar region.

Then, she’ll be seen twisting like one does while killing an insect under their shoe.

There are other finishing moves apart from this, like two roundhouse kicks to the skull of the enemy player.

The other one is a karate chop aimed at the neck of the enemy.

The rapper’s character can also be seen voicing lines from her songs, one such is “I need an ‘F’, ‘R’, ‘E’, AK-47.” The other one is “I’m the alpha, the omega, and everything in between.”

The Baddest battle rifle and Super Freaky shotgun are in a default pink bejeweled with the name Bryson on them. Nicki leaves pink paint splashes as she fires on various surfaces.

Also, she turns the enemies into Pepto Bismol’s burst and confetti while killing them.
